So CryptoTrader.Tax (also known as CoinLedger) formats their CSV's specifically for your service, however, when uploading a CSV it is making me manually review hundreds of transactions. I'm following the steps both on this website and on CryptoTrader's website, but the system still makes me review these transactions and manually correct them one-by-one. This is tough because I have hundreds of transactions. Also, the system keeps asking me for a 1099-B from CryptoTrader, when in the past, all I needed to do was upload my CSV file from them.
Can anyone give insight into why this is now occurring when it wasn't last year or even a month ago? Did TurboTax change something on their side, like steps, etc? I ask because I followed the steps on adding crypto to TurboTax below and it still makes me review these transactions manually. Yet the guide mentions nothing about needing to do this.

Same issue here. Upon reviewing one of the transactions, it appears that TurboTax wants a box filled in on how you receive the investment. See attached image. Also inspecting the cvs from CryptoTradet.tax (aka Coinledger), there is not a column to reflect this. Again see attached image. I am going reach out to Cryptotrader.tax as well.

I posted the same question on Reddit and someone replied that he bypassed the question page and submitted it to the feds and they accepted it.
I did the same after going through about 40 out of 500 reviews and noticed that my return stayed the same amount. So I submitted it to federal and state(oregon). The feds accepted it right way, but oregon rejected for a different reason. I resubmitted and Oregon accepted it also. So I think that it defaults as 'I bought it' when it's sent in. Here is the fix with the issue. https://cryptotrader.tax/blog/how-to-file-your-cryptocurrency-taxes-with-turbotax
Important Note: Do not be alarmed if TurboTax asks you to review each imported crypto transaction individually within the the completecheck™ to-do list. Your cryptocurrency transactions have already been reviewed from within CryptoTrader.Tax. You can skip this individual review process by scrolling to the bottom of this page (sometimes hundreds of transactions) and clicking continue.

I hope you see this. I had the same issue and figured it out.
They changed their name to coinledger and if you select this option prior to upload you will be able to file without manually reviewing everything.
Go to the income screen and delete the entire crypto trader you previously uploaded. Then rue-load it and select coinledger. You will now be able to file the return without manually doing anything.
